Test House Report on Tungsten Points AQ and HR.
The report from Mr. Warwick on the above points is to the following effect.
No trouble has been experienced with these contact points.
As regards attention, all contact points whether standard or tungsten, are inspected and cleaned every 2,000 miles as per instruction book.
